How can moving average indicators be helpful in forex trading?

It is very important for an existing trader as well as a newbie to know how to correctly interpret technical indicators so that they may be helpful to them in carrying out the forex trade efficiently as well as gain good profits. Constant and correct interpretation of the forex trading technical tools may help in avoiding failures. Moving average is one technical indicator which is very well liked and also commonly used among the forex professionals and experts. Further are some details by which you can know what exactly is meant by a moving average indicator and how can it be useful to the forex traders.

All the technical indicators are very useful and quite easy to use. Moving averages are one of the most well liked as well as easy to use technical indicator. Forex technical analysis is extremely subjective but the moving average indicators are very specific mathematically and also very objective. The moving averages symbolize a lot of important and also frequently used provisions of forex trading and this is the reason because of which they are very widely used and also very popular among the forex traders. Moving averages are not only vital for momentum, isolating trends and support/resistance but also very important for highlighting the underlying bias of the overriding trading cycles. In the forex market moving averages are used by the traders to make their important forex investment decisions. It also proves to be helpful for calculating the current averages of the forex currency price.

The moving averages are considered as the most basic and core trend identifying indicators by the professionals in the forex market and thus they are known as the highly useful technical tool. Moving averages also act as resistance and support levels in a trending market. Usually forex traders adopt simple moving averages for long period by which they identify long term trend changes. When a trader uses moving averages in a combination with another then the shorter one is used for the timing purposes and the and the longer one is used for identifying the trends in the forex market. But the moving averages become flat and are considered useless when there is no trend prevailing in the forex market. But a forex market is a trending market and thus the moving averages are of great use.

Moving averages are further classified into five types: simple, exponential, triangular, variable, and weighted. Out of the five “simple” and “exponential” are the most prominently used and also well liked moving averages. Simple moving averages are popular as they offer simple computation. Simple moving averages apply equal weights to the prices and are derived by finding out the average price of a currency or currency pair for over a specified number of periods of time.

The forex traders make use of the exponential moving averages for charting prices on the currency market. Exponential moving averages apply more weights to the recent prices than the old prices thus reducing the lag. But then the method in which this average is calculated is a little difficult.

Thus, moving averages in date are considered the best and the most useful technical indicators. The trader who masters the skill of interpreting the moving averages as well as the other forex trading tools is likely to gain big profits in his forex trading and become wealthier day by day.

How can a momentum indicator help you in forex trading?

The market “momentum” is an important forex indicator with regards to the strength of a trend, or whether the trend is going to begin or end. Gaining a proper knowledge of the forex market is important this is possible by examining the forex charts, signals, cycles and other technical indicators. A study of near term fundamental analysis is also important. There are some times when the forex tools have to be employed for a proper trade in forex. One such technical tool is Momentum indicator.

 Momentum indicator refers to a technical study which is quite popular.  It is very simple to calculate and it can also be practiced in many different ways. Momentum is always calculated by dividing the closing price of the day with the closing price a few amount of days ago and then multiplying the quotient by 100.  A momentum is a technical analysis indicator which is considered to be an oscillator type of a study and is usually used for understanding an over brought or an over sold market. It also helps in determining the speed at which the prices rise and fall. This indicates whether the market is over brought or over sold, whether the pace of the trend is slowing down and whether the current trend prevailing in the forex market is losing or gaining momentum.

 The computation of constant differences between the prices at fixed intervals is referred to as Momentum. This difference can either be positive or negative. And it is plotted around the zero line. When the prices increase at an increasing rate the momentum is said to be above the zero line and considered to be increasing. But when the momentum is still above the zero line but decreasing then prices in the forex market are still increasing but at a decreasing rate.

 The normal trading rule is that a trader should buy at a point when the momentum line crosses above from below the zero line. And the trader should sell when the momentum line crosses below from above the zero line. Another possibility is that the trader may establish bands at each extremes of the momentum line. The trader should modify his rules of entering and exiting the market with the help of momentum indicator.

The trader can always specify the length of the momentum indicator. It is also important for a forex trader to decide a suitable value with regards to his forex trading needs and methods. There is usually an argument that arises between the technical analyst and the technicians that the momentum indicator and the normal price cycle should be equal. It is always advisable to trade with different length where in after experiments the trader will find out which is the best and most profitable.

Thus, to conclude with there are many technical analysis indicators which are used in a combination or as singles for a profitable trade. These indicators are useful for both newbie’s and all the existing forex traders.
